James M. Haynes

James M. “Jimmy” Haynes, 35, of Galesburg, died at 11:02 a.m. Tuesday, May 9, 2017 at home.

Jimmy was born on December 30, 1981 in Galesburg, the son of Michael E. and Leslie J. Webber Haynes. Jimmy is survived by his mother, Leslie Haynes of Galesburg; his father, Mike (Jan) Haynes of Galesburg; three daughters, McKenzie and Maza Haynes both at home, and Riley Haynes of LeClaire, IA; one sister, Lindsey (Caleb) Jones of Gilson; and his beloved dog, Otis. He is also survived by one step sister, KayDee (Jason) Nelson of Galesburg; and his step grandmother, JoAnne Rabenau of Galesburg. He was preceded in death by his maternal grandparents, Les and Shirley Webber; paternal grandparents, Emery and Joan Haynes; and his step grandfather, Tom Rabenau.

According to his wishes cremation rites have been accorded and private family services have been held. No public services are planned. Private family burial has taken place in St. Joseph’s Cemetery.
